x Nova Scotia Postmaster Arthur Woodgate´s Essay 1851, essay by Postmaster Woodgate of a Three Pence design and a proposed oval cancellation, executed in pen and ink with brown watercolour, both depicted in the margin of the file copy of his letter of April 21, 1851 addressed to the Hon. Joseph Howe, the Provincial Secretary of Nova Scotia; the two drawings have been cut out and replaced. An important document and a wonderful frontispiece to any collection of Nova Scotia Estimate US$ 10,000-15,000provenance: Dale/Lichtenstein, November 1968 (sale 2) H. Kanai
